If you waited too long for the bike to cool down, the oil may just have been height enough in the sight glass. You are meant to check the oil when hot really.

The FZS600 oil light is an oil level light so chances are, it is a tad low and going round a corner, accelerating or braking hard was just enough to activate the level switch.
